- Reasons as to why you think you deserve a refund:

Quote:4.2. Road Laws
Cops must obey road laws when not in a chase.
Breaking road laws will be tolerated for short periods if it's necessary to get speeding evidence (!laser) or to initiate a chase, provided it is done with all due care and remains within a reasonable relation to the pursued offence.

They got the !laser for which they ultimately fined me in the 80km/h limit in the Cattle Market, not on Highway 2 from where they were applying rule 4.2 to originally try and catch up to get a !laser on me, after around 20 seconds and an entire kilometre of speeding.

I personally believe this to be an excessive amount and more than "for short periods" and "within a reasonable relation to the pursued offence" stated in rule 4.2.

Some may have the perspective that this is a different offence, which I could usually somewhat agree with, however in this case I would argue that they would not physically have been able to get the !laser in the Cattle Market for which they ultimately fined me without first speeding heavily to catch up to me for those 20 seconds down the entire length of Highway 2 which I believe to be an excessive amount of time for the reason stated previously.

Hi Gaz,

Thank you for your well written refund request. Apologies for the delay, Christmas and New Year were busy times for everyone at TC.

I've reviewed the replay and discussed it with members of the team because it was close to the wire. Upon discussing this and reviewing the replay, we have decided to deny the refund request. This is because whilst the cop did exceed the speed limit for just over 15 seconds (16.32 I believe but can't be certain) before clocking you, this could be deemed just within reason with regards to rule 4.2. However, factors such as the cop's driving (correct side, appropriate use of visual and audible warnings and control at speed) and the fact that it was a single road with a known endpoint (being the cattle market) made it a safe situation in order to catch up to a suspect who is doing very high speeds. Screenshots were taken at the points where the cop exceeded the limit, peak speed and lasering you in the cattle market, which amounted to the time mentioned above and used in evidence.

Thank you for your request again, I appreciate this is a unique situation that is close to the wire, and the decision has not been made lightly.
